The US Embassy urges its citizens to leave Iran through the border with Azerbaijan

The US Virtual Embassy in Iran has called on its citizens to leave the country.
As reported by BAKU.WS, the corresponding notification was published on the website of the virtual diplomatic mission.
"US citizens should not visit Iran for any reason, and if they are there, they should immediately leave the territory of this country. US citizens who cannot leave Iran should be prepared to remain in shelter for an extended period," the notification states.
It is noted that Washington does not have diplomatic or consular relations with Tehran, and Switzerland acts as the protecting power for US interests. The embassy suggested that its citizens leave Iran through the border with Azerbaijan, Armenia, or Turkey.
It is noted that US citizens can enter Azerbaijan through the "Astara" border checkpoint. Before heading to the border, they must obtain permission from the Azerbaijani government. The mission reported that citizens wishing to cross into Azerbaijan should contact the US Embassy in Baku.
